Your position

In your new position as HV Technician in the Renewables Division, you will be a valuable member of the dedicated MV/HV Service Team who specializes in providing electrical services for offshore wind projects. 

Your team is dedicated to testing Power Systems and modifications and plays a crucial role in our efforts to establish ourselves as a leading service provider in the rapidly growing offshore wind industry. In this role, you will function as a Technician within the Medium Voltage and High Voltage electrical field and get the chance to work with many exciting and complex systems.

 

Your tasks & responsibilities 

As HV Technician, you will have a variety of Service and Maintenance tasks on Offshore Substations, Wind Turbines and Oil & Gas Drilling Units. 

Your tasks will include but are not limited to Electrical Services from Low Voltage to 220kV primarily in the following areas;

  • Maintenance of Offshore Substations (OSS) and Wind Turbines (WTG)
  • Special periodic survey (SPS) of Drilling Riggs and Drill Ships
  • Service tasks on Switchgears and Transformers  
  • Test of protection devices such as relay, circuit brakers etc.

 

Your profile & qualifications 

What we value most for this position is a strong understanding of - and interest in - the MV/HV electrical field. We are a supportive team who prioritizes each other and safety above all else. As such, a strong safety mindset and a collaborative, team-oriented approach to your work is a must.

To succeed in this position, we imagine that you have:

  • An educational background as an Electrician
  • Experience in working with Medium and High Voltage Cables, Transformers and Switchgear
  • Documented Switching experience on High voltage equipment is advantageous
  • GWO training including HUET certificates
  • Work permits to working in the EU
